Manchester City's giant shadow is looming large in the rear-view mirror of their rivals as they make one of those familiar charges that turns up the psychological pressure and invariably ends in success.

It is that time of the season again. It is the time when Pep Guardiola's reigning champions gather their forces for the home run and ask the searching questions of those such as Liverpool and Arsenal who hope to beat them to the big prizes.

And this was the inescapable feeling once more as City recorded a ninth successive win in all competitions with a 3-1 win at Brentford, a victory achieved with much to spare despite trailing to Neal Maupay's breakaway goal until the closing seconds of the first half.

City are now in second place, two points behind leaders Liverpool after their defeat at Arsenal on Sunday. One of the sub-plots of that result was that it put City's Premier League destiny back in their own hands, which is how they like it.

They will go top, for a few hours at least, if they beat struggling Everton at the Etihad Stadium on Saturday lunchtime before Liverpool face Burnley at Anfield. And City still have a game in hand.
